Historical Sites

Agadir or Taghazout Sightseeing Old City With Big Market - Historical Sites

With a rich tapestry of history woven into its streets, Agadir and Taghazout boast an array of captivating historical sites waiting to be explored.

Visitors can marvel at architectural wonders like the Kasbah of Agadir, a fortress that stands as a testament to the city’s resilience after a devastating earthquake. The kasbah offers stunning panoramic views of the city and the Atlantic Ocean.

In Taghazout, travelers can enjoy the cultural significance of sites like old mosques and traditional Berber architecture. These historical landmarks provide insight into the rich heritage of the region, offering a glimpse into the past and showcasing the enduring traditions that have shaped Agadir and Taghazout into the vibrant destinations they are today.

Culinary Delights

Delving into the culinary landscape of Agadir and Taghazout reveals a tapestry of flavors that intertwine traditional Moroccan dishes with coastal influences. Food exploration in these coastal towns offers a unique gastronomic experience, combining the richness of Moroccan spices with the freshness of seafood. Visitors can indulge in traditional dishes such as tagine, couscous, and pastilla, all prepared with local ingredients and authentic recipes passed down through generations. The fusion of Berber, Moorish, and Arab culinary traditions creates a diverse menu that caters to various palates. Whether savoring a fragrant lamb tagine or enjoying freshly caught fish grilled to perfection, the dining options in Agadir and Taghazout promise a memorable journey for the taste buds.
